Solar Generation Forecast 0.0.2
Arman Puri
Solar Generation Forecast involves knowledgeofthe Sun´s path, weather condition, thescattering processes and the characteristics of a solar energyplantwhich utilizes the Sun's energy tocreate solar power. Solar photovoltaic systems transformsolarenergy into electric power. The poweroutput depends on the incoming radiation and on the solarpanelcharacteristics.This App has been uniquely designed to forecast Solarpowergeneration for a plant. It has followingmajor features:* It allows to configure the master data for a solar powerplant.Parameters like longitude, latitude,power generation capacity, type of solar panels used etc.* It captures weather data, sun radiation, day temperature forthenext day for the plant locationfrom authenticated sites using web APIs.* Based on the plant parameters and forecast data, it calculatestheapproximate power generationfor the next day.* User can maintain master data for multiple locations. The Appwillcalculate power generationforecast for all the locations.* GPS and Mobile Data/ Wifi should be "ON" to run this APP.
Solar Rooftop Installer 1.0
Arman Puri
Solar Panels can be installed on rooftopsofinstitutes and homes to meet daily electricityrequirements. In order to maximize the solar power yield, it isveryimportant that the panels areinstalled in correct direction, angle and location within thegivenperiphery.This App has been uniquely designed to help users to identifybestlocation for solar panel installation.Important features of the App are as under:* It identifies Longitude and Latitude of the location* It identifies the current direction and angle of themobilescreen* It compares the current direction and angle with the mostoptimumdirection and angle for solarpanel installation. As soon as the current direction matcheswithoptimum direction (+/- 5 degree)and optimum angle (+/- 2 degree), the readings turn green.* User can measure the light intensity at the identifiedlocation.He can set the time duration ( 1hour to 10 hours) and interval (5 minutes to 60 minutes) forwhichhe wants to measure the lightintensity.* App will calculate the average light intensity for thegivenduration (Device must have lightsensor).* This way, user can measure light intensity at variouslocationswithin the given periphery andidentify the best location.* App has a report section where user can see previously storedsetof readings.* GPS and mobile data/ wifi should be "ON" to run this APP.
